"Zoe's the smartest," said Vanessa, "I'm the best actress, and you, Winifred Fletcher . . ." she said, turning to Winnie. "You are the best-" Winnie waited to hear what Vanessa would say. It seemed as if Vanessa had to check every cupboard in her brain to find an answer. How do you know if you're really good at something and not just ordinary? Can you be the best at something if you really want to? With humor and insight, Jennifer Richard Jacobson captures the complex emotions of jealousy, competition, self-doubt, and, ultimately, self-acceptance.
